Here are some facts about Rick Riordan, author of the Percy Jackson and the Olympians series. Rick Riordan was born on 5th June 1964 in San Antonio, Texas (United States). He went to Alamo Heights High School and then attended the University of Texas. read more

Oooh. I’ve got a few. I absolutely adore Rick Riordan. Rick was a middle school and high school teacher when he lived in San Antonio, prior to being an author. His first love was Norse mythology. Rick knows a little bit of Spanish (enough to be conversational and communicate with Latinx fans), most likely due to being from Texas. read more

Fact 4 – As a boy, Riordan was fond of reading on Greek and Norse mythology, fantasy, science fiction, and mysteries. Lord of the Rings was among Riordan’s favorite books. Fact 5 – Riordan shot to fame with his Tres Navarre mystery series. read more
